Presentations

PRESENTATION OF CLASS SHOVEL.

In accordance with the precedent set by those who have left this hall of learning before us, as president of the gradu¬ating class, I present to the president of the Junior Class this shovel, which has taken part in many an Arbor Day program. May you, in using it, add another set of class colors to its adornment and thus in your turn pass on the happy custom to the class which succeeds you.
DAVID WARD WHITE.

ACCEPTANCE OF CLASS SHOVEL.

Mr. President: I, as President of the Junior Class, wish to say that I consider it a great honor to be presented with this shovel, which from year to year has been passed down from the Senior Class to the Junior Class. I now thank you most heartily for this gift and I shall see to it that it is properly taken care of and used in the traditional manner.
MARION FRANCES EATON.
President, Junior Class.

PRESENTATION OF CLASS GIFT.

Four years of combined work and pleasure have brought us to this graduation time. Indeed, it is with some little regret that we leave this institution of learning which has done so much towards preparing us for greater problems which we are to meet in life.

As a small token of our esteem and gratitude, we take great pleasure in presenting to the school through Doctor Dawson, our principal, a flag to be carried in parades during the future years.
DAVID WARD WHITE.
